Justin Bieber's manager thinks his "prick" behaviour is other people's fault

  • July 23, 2012
  • Joel Freeman

Scooter Braun, manager of Justin Bieber and Carly 'Rae' Rae Jepsen has responded to claims from CSI producers that Justin was a bit of a prick on set.

Acknowledging accus­a­tions that the 'Christmas Song (Chestnuts Roasting on an Open Fire)' hitmaker punched a cake and locked a producer in a cupboard on the set, Scooter recalled an earlier con­ver­sa­tion with producers, saying: "I said, 'Let me ask you a question. When he locked you in the closet, did you tell him you were angry?' He goes, 'No, I needed him to work, so I laughed.'"

"And I said, 'So he saw you acknow­ledge his joke and say it's OK? Then you're more to blame than him. He's a kid — he's waiting for someone to tell him where the limits are."

"At the end of the day, even in his most selfish moments you just need to point out that he's being selfish," Scooter told Rolling Stone magazine. "He's more embar­rassed about it than anything. When he's being a prick, he's not being a prick because he's famous. He's being a prick because he's a kid."

That resolves that, then.
